Painting Description
Henri Peters Gray's "Paris and Helen" is an evocative painting that delves into the mythological narrative of Paris, the Trojan prince, and Helen, whose abduction sparked the legendary Trojan War. Painted in the 19th century, this artwork is a testament to Gray's fascination with classical themes and his ability to capture the emotional intensity of mythological subjects.
The painting portrays the moment of intimacy and connection between Paris and Helen, encapsulating the allure and tragedy that their union symbolizes. Gray's use of color, light, and composition highlights the romantic and dramatic elements of the story. The figures of Paris and Helen are rendered with meticulous attention to detail, emphasizing their idealized beauty and the tension between their fateful love and the impending doom it heralds.
Gray's "Paris and Helen" is notable for its adherence to the academic style prevalent during his time, characterized by its polished technique and adherence to classical ideals of beauty and form. The artist's skillful use of chiaroscuro enhances the three-dimensionality of the figures, creating a sense of depth and realism that draws the viewer into the scene.
The painting reflects the 19th-century European fascination with antiquity and the romanticization of classical myths. It serves as a visual exploration of themes such as love, destiny, and the consequences of human actions, which were central to the myth of Paris and Helen. Gray's interpretation of this mythological episode invites viewers to reflect on the timeless nature of these themes and their relevance to contemporary life.
"Paris and Helen" by Henri Peters Gray remains a significant work within the artist's oeuvre and within the broader context of 19th-century academic painting. Its enduring appeal lies in its ability to convey the emotional and narrative depth of one of history's most enduring love stories.
